Social Identity Theory
A theory of group formation and maintenance that stresses the need of individual members to feel a sense of belonging.
Teamwork
The collaborative effort of a group aimed at achieving a common goal or completing a task in the most effective and efficient way.
Shared Social Identity
Shared social identity is the sense of belonging to a specific group or community, which influences one’s feelings, actions, and interactions with others within the same social category.
Structural Functionalism
A sociological perspective that emphasizes the societal structures' role in maintaining stability and order within a society.
